News Corp. Buys Stake in Student Journalism Firm Palestra

Authored by Mark Hefflinger on August 19, 2008 - 7:02am.

New York - Rupert Murdoch's News Corp. (NYSE: NWS) bought a minority stake in student journalism site Palestra.net in May, and will begin including student-reported news pieces on its Fox News Channel and Fox Business Network in the fall, Forbes.com reports.

Financial terms of the deal were not disclosed.

Palestra currently counts some 125 reporters at 101 schools in the U.S.

The company pays between $240 and $300 to students who produce three news packages per week for its website and Fox's networks.

Fox's relationship with Palestra began last November, when a Palestra student reporter filed a story during wildfires near Pepperdine University in Malibu, Calif.
